Location:
Aberdeen
Job Summary:
• Assistance in implementation of property plans and tactics to effectively manage the facilities activities related to the assigned portfolio to ensure investment protection, business continuity, cost management and rightsizing the portfolio to meet present demands.
• Assistance in day to day monitoring of maintenance tasks (reactive and preventive) in close liaison with the assigned IFM contractor.
• Build a sustainable database of landlord and managing agents for the Scotland portfolio, and further to extend to the Continental Europe sites.
• Assist with site visits, inspections and audits (travel required to sites around Aberdeen)
Responsibilities and Duties:
• Assists with the scheduling of regulatory required tasks by site
• Maintain sustainability database
• Actively participate in implementation of energy management strategy at facilities
• Updates and/or creates required database information with facility master data
• Manages reactive maintenance tasks with the IFM contractor to ensure on time delivery
• Requests and manages RFQ for facilities requirements
• Assists facility manager with Cost/Value assessments for all activities
• Monitors and enforces Soft Services routines and measures service delivery quality
• Effectively communicates with and maintains the highest degree of relations between the Company and all levels of supplier personnel.
• Builds strong relationships with internal customers in order to meet defined objectives.
• Identifies opportunities and implements actions to continually reduce wasted time, money and resources from assigned tasks.
• Complies with all SLB and local procedures applicable to the job function.
• Employees may be assigned other duties in addition to, or in lieu of those described above, per the needs of the location or Company.
